早教吧作业答案频道 -->其他-->
matlab 怎么编循环函数求助大神帮我把下面程序改成‘0.005’这个值为【0.005;0.001;0.015】的循环函数clc;f=@(x)([3*log10(x(1))-2*log10(0.005)-0.3060*0.005+0.088*x(1)-2020.8*x(2)+19.21;2*log10(0.005)+3*log10(x(2))-11.61*
题目详情
matlab 怎么编循环函数
求助大神帮我把下面程序改成‘0.005’这个值为【0.005;0.001;0.015】
的循环函数
clc;
f=@(x)([3*log10(x(1))-2*log10(0.005)-0.3060*0.005+0.088*x(1)-2020.8*x(2)+19.21;2*log10(0.005)+3*log10(x(2))-11.61*0.005-813.0940*x(1)-13.8*x(2)+14.54]);
x0=[0.0000001;0.00002];
x=fsolve(f,x0)
digits(10)
vpa(x)
求助大神帮我把下面程序改成‘0.005’这个值为【0.005;0.001;0.015】
的循环函数
clc;
f=@(x)([3*log10(x(1))-2*log10(0.005)-0.3060*0.005+0.088*x(1)-2020.8*x(2)+19.21;2*log10(0.005)+3*log10(x(2))-11.61*0.005-813.0940*x(1)-13.8*x(2)+14.54]);
x0=[0.0000001;0.00002];
x=fsolve(f,x0)
digits(10)
vpa(x)
▼优质解答
答案和解析
digits(10)
for i = [0.005 0.001 0.015]
f=@(x)([3*log10(x(1))-2*log10(i)-0.3060*i+0.088*x(1)-2020.8*x(2)+19.21;
2*log10(i)+3*log10(x(2))-11.61*i-813.0940*x(1)-13.8*x(2)+14.54]);
x0=[0.0000001; 0.00002];
disp('----');
x = fsolve(f,x0)
vpa(x)
end
for i = [0.005 0.001 0.015]
f=@(x)([3*log10(x(1))-2*log10(i)-0.3060*i+0.088*x(1)-2020.8*x(2)+19.21;
2*log10(i)+3*log10(x(2))-11.61*i-813.0940*x(1)-13.8*x(2)+14.54]);
x0=[0.0000001; 0.00002];
disp('----');
x = fsolve(f,x0)
vpa(x)
end
看了 matlab 怎么编循环函数...的网友还看了以下:
若f(x)在R上是奇函数,且f(1)=0.f(x)/x的导数大于0(x大于0).则f(x)/x在x小 2020-03-31 …
求解答函数题0=Y-Y(0.01+0.17)-X/0.7-(3*X*0.005)解0=Y-Y(0. 2020-04-07 …
当0大于x大于等于1/2时,4的x次幂小于logaX(a大于0且a不等于1),则a的取值范围log 2020-06-16 …
在函数f(x)=sinx/x(x→0)中,不论x为多少f(x)值都为0.017452406但在Li 2020-06-24 …
若x+y<0,xy<0,x>y,则有()。A.x>0,y>0,x的绝对值较大B.x>0,y<0,y 2020-07-15 …
求解应用题...题.小明家里有3000斤粮食,每斤4圆,在出售的时候每100斤扣去5斤,请问最后卖 2020-07-16 …
设[x)表示大于x的最小整数,如[3)=4,[-1.2)=-1,则下列结论:①[0)=0;②[x) 2020-07-29 …
f(x)在开区间(a,b)导数大于等于0,f(a)=0,为什么书上说f(x)在(a,b)上是大于0 2020-08-01 …
命题:“若x、y、z都大于0,则xyz>0”的逆否命题是()A.若xyz<0,则x、y、z都不大于 2020-08-01 …
已知0大于x小于1/3则(1—3x)最大值为什么不能x=1-3x算这样不是基本不等式的最终的解法吗 2021-01-22 …